Philip A. Jennings is a scholar working on Molecular Biology, Genetics and Radiology, Nuclear Medicine and Imaging. According to data from OpenAlex, Philip A. Jennings has authored 15 papers receiving a total of 706 ind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Molecular Biology, 4 papers in Genetics and 2 papers in Radiology, Nuclear Medicine and Imaging. Recurrent topics in Philip A. Jennings’s work include RNA and protein synthesis mechanisms (7 papers), Bacterial Genetics and Biotechnology (3 papers) and DNA Repair Mechanisms (3 papers). Philip A. Jennings is often cited by papers focused on RNA and protein synthesis mechanisms (7 papers), Bacterial Genetics and Biotechnology (3 papers) and DNA Repair Mechanisms (3 papers). Philip A. Jennings collaborates with scholars based in Australia, United Kingdom and Norway. Philip A. Jennings's co-authors include Brian P. Dalrymple, Gene Wijffels, Nicholas E. Dixon, Kritaya Kongsuwan, J.T. Finch, James S. Robertson, Greg Winter, Philip Hendry, Maxine J. McCall and Fernando S. Santiago and has published in prestigious journals such as Cell, Proceedings of the National Academy of Sciences and Nucleic Acids Research.
